DUBLIN, Ireland - Two men remain in custody following Thursday's drug raid at a home in the North Inner City of Dublin.
The 2 men, aged in their 30s and 40s, are being detained at a Dublin Garda Station.
Thursday's raid was carried out as part of Operation Tara and as a result of ongoing operations undertaken by the Dublin Crime Response Team (DCRT) targeting the sale and supply of illicit drugs in the Dublin Region.
During the course of the search, Cannabis Herb, Cannabis Resin, MDMA, and Ketamine, with a combined estimated street sale value of €125,000, was seized, along with €8,000 cash.
Gardai say investigations are ongoing.
